About

Alasdair MacKellar is a scholar working on Surgery,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Emergency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Alasdair MacKellar has authored 38 papers receiving a total of 320 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Surgery, 9 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and 7 papers in Emergency Medicine. Recurrent topics in Alasdair MacKellar's work include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(5 papers), Injury Epidemiology and Prevention (4 papers) and Pediatric Urology and Nephrology Studies (4 papers). Alasdair MacKellar is often cited by papers focused on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(5 papers), Injury Epidemiology and Prevention (4 papers) and Pediatric Urology and Nephrology Studies (4 papers). Alasdair MacKellar coll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United Kingdom and Israel. Alasdair MacKellar's co-authors include F. Douglas Stephens, P. L. Masters, Helen Hilton, Paul Sprague, Graham Buckton, Clyde Orr, J.M. Newton, W. D. A. Ford, Chad J. Richardson and D.M. Griffiths and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Pharmaceutics, Schizophrenia Research and Archives of Disease in Childhood.
